According to our (Global Info Research) latest study, the global Magnetostrictive Distance Transducers market size was valued at US$ 206 million in 2024 and is forecast to a readjusted size of USD 321 million by 2031 with a CAGR of 6.8% during review period.

Magnetostrictive distance transducers (MDS sensors) are displacement measurement devices based on the principle of the magnetostrictive effect. The magnetostrictive effect refers to the change in length of certain materials when subjected to an external magnetic field, with the change being proportional to the strength of the magnetic field. This principle is utilized in the development of precise displacement sensors to measure linear displacement, distance, and position.

The operation of MDS sensors typically involves the deformation of magnetostrictive materials within the sensor, in combination with changes in the external magnetic field, providing high-precision, non-contact displacement measurements. MDS sensors are widely used in industries such as industrial automation, liquid level monitoring, robotics, and aerospace. Compared to traditional contact sensors, magnetostrictive distance transducers offer significant advantages, including stable operation in harsh environments, avoiding wear and tear, which enhances the reliability and lifespan of the equipment.

With the continuous advancement of industrial automation and the growing demand for precise measurement, the market demand for magnetostrictive distance transducers is steadily increasing. Especially in fields where high precision and non-contact measurement are required, these sensors, due to their unique technical advantages, are gradually replacing traditional displacement sensors and becoming one of the mainstream choices in the market.

Currently, with the rapid development of smart manufacturing, robotics, and automation control systems, the application of magnetostrictive sensors is expanding in the industrial sector. For example, in liquid level monitoring systems, MDS sensors provide accurate measurements of liquid levels, applicable in industries such as petroleum, chemicals, and food; in robotics, these sensors enable precise measurement of robotic motion, ensuring accuracy in operations.

Moreover, with the increasing demand for equipment reliability and operational lifespan, MDS sensors, due to their non-contact working principle, avoid the wear and tear that contact sensors may experience in harsh environments, making them widely favored. Especially in high-temperature, corrosive, and high-vibration environments, magnetostrictive sensors can maintain stable performance, ensuring long-term reliable operation.

Key drivers for the market include the push for smart manufacturing and the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T), which is driving a continuous rise in the demand for high-precision sensors. Additionally, the growing global focus on environmental monitoring, energy management, and other fields has shown the enormous potential of MDS sensors in these applications. Furthermore, the continuous technological advancements in magnetostrictive sensors, including improvements in accuracy, stability, and cost-effectiveness, are key factors contributing to the market's growth.
